New Foster’s Grill Franchise Owner Predicts June Opening in Falls Church

FALLS CHURCH, Va., — Nicole No, franchise owner of the new Foster’s Grill restaurant that will open in a downtown Falls Church location this summer, was in Falls Church to meet with Becky Witsman of the City of Falls Church Economic Development Office and Sally Cole, executive director of the Falls Church Chamber of Commerce Thursday. Ms. No said that her plans are to have her restaurant open by June. It will be located on the ground floor of The Spectrum, the new mixed use project at 444 W. Broad Street, facing onto Pennsylvania Avenue.
